Wildrose Synopsis
June Lorich works at the Mesabi Mine on Minnesota's iron range. After an emotionally and physically abusive marriage, June is determined to make it on her own. But the worsening steel industry forces major cutbacks and June is bumped down to an all-male pit. She becomes the brunt of the other workers' hostilities and is forced to fight against them -- and the man she loves -- to save her job.
Wildrose (1984) is a drama film directed by John Hanson, released on May 4, 1984 with a runtime of 1h 35m. It stars Lisa Eichhorn, Tom Bower, Stephen Yoakam and Cinda Jackson. Viewers rate it 4.5 out of 10 across 2 ratings.
